Sharepoint 如何将数据上传到共享点?
我不熟悉这个outlook共享点 我需要通过REST将文件上载到microsoft sharepoint 有谁能指导我这样做吗?我们可以通过C使用CSOM来实现这一点,这里有一个演示供您参考:Sharepoint 如何将数据上传到共享点?,sharepoint,sharepoint-2013,apache-nifi,Sharepoint,Sharepoint 2013,Apache Nifi,我不熟悉这个outlook共享点 我需要通过REST将文件上载到microsoft sharepoint 有谁能指导我这样做吗?我们可以通过C使用CSOM来实现这一点,这里有一个演示供您参考: /// <summary> /// upload file to Document Library /// </summary> /// <param name="context"></param> /// <p
/// <summary>
/// upload file to Document Library
/// </summary>
/// <param name="context"></param>
/// <param name="documentLibraryName">MyDocLib</param>
/// <param name="filePath">C:\\</param>
/// <param name="fileName">hello2.txt</param>
public static void uploadFile(ClientContext context, string documentLibraryName, string filePath, string fileName)
{
string siteURL = context.Url.EndsWith("/") ? context.Url.Substring(0, context.Url.Length - 1) : context.Url;
List list = context.Web.Lists.GetByTitle(documentLibraryName);
context.Load(list);
context.ExecuteQuery();
FileStream fileStream = new FileStream(filePath, FileMode.Open);
FileCreationInformation newFileInfo = new FileCreationInformation()
{
ContentStream = fileStream,
Url = siteURL + "/" + documentLibraryName + "/" + fileName,
Overwrite = true
};
Microsoft.SharePoint.Client.File file = list.RootFolder.Files.Add(newFileInfo);
context.Load(file);
context.ExecuteQuery();
}
//
///将文件上载到文档库
///
///
///MyDocLib
///C:\\
///hello2.txt
公共静态无效上载文件(ClientContext上下文、字符串文档库名称、字符串文件路径、字符串文件名)
{
string siteURL=context.Url.EndsWith(“/”)?context.Url.Substring(0,context.Url.Length-1):context.Url;
List List=context.Web.Lists.GetByTitle(documentLibraryName);
加载(列表);
context.ExecuteQuery();
FileStream FileStream=newfilestream(filePath,FileMode.Open);
FileCreationInformation newFileInfo=新文件CreationInformation()
{
ContentStream=fileStream,
Url=siteURL+“/”+文档库名称+“/”+文件名,
覆盖=真
};
Microsoft.SharePoint.Client.File File=list.RootFolder.Files.Add(newFileInfo);
加载(文件);
context.ExecuteQuery();
}
CSOM库下载链接:
有关CSOM的更多信息:
关于Rest API,我们可以参考以下链接:
好的,让我帮你用谷歌搜索一下…@tinamou,谢谢你“访问路径被拒绝”